WebFor four-lane freeways, the minimum shoulder widths must be 10-ft on the outside and 4-ft on the inside (median). On freeways of six lanes or more, 10-ft inside shoulders must be provided for emergency pull-offs. A 10-ft outside shoulder must be maintained along all speed change lanes. Web3. Slope the second lane out from the crown or top of cross section at 0.02 regardless of the first-lane cross slope. 4. Increase the slope of each successive pair of lanes by 0.005—e.g. slope the third and fourth lane out from the crown at 0.025. 5. Avoid cross slopes steeper than 0.03 on tangent roadways wherever practical. WebLane Width and Number The usual and minimum lane width is 13-ft. Web10 nov. 2024 · Collector lanes have a 10-foot minimum width if there are less than 400 drivers traveling that highway daily. This minimum goes up to 11 feet if up to 2,000 people travel the highway daily, and 12 feet if more than 2,000 people use it every day. Travel lanes have the same minimum width as collector lanes.
